Abstract

Orthotopic heart transplantation (OHT) has evolved as the "gold standard" therapy for end stage cardiomyopathy, Advances in the fields of immunosuppression, infection prophylaxis and treatment, surgical techniques as well as intensice care management have transformed heart transplantation from what was once considered an experimental intervention into a standard therapy. This chapter focuses on the standard care for OHT including surgical techniques, perioperative management and management of common postoperative complications.
